Three cells, each of e.m.f 1.5 V and internal resistance 1 ohm are connected in parallel. What would be the e.m.f of the combination
Options
(a) 4.5 V
(b) 1.5 V
(c) 3.0 V
(d) none of these
Correct Answer:
1.5 V
